MANAGEMENT <br />/?ZCz1V,e® <br />25Z011 <br />41111;nv 0170f /8fe Ab <br />The DRMS' letter dated March 4, 2011 transmitted its adequacy comments regarding <br />TR-60. Following are Snowcap's responses to the DRMS' comments and concerns: <br />1. DRMS: Page A14-11-4, Species Diversity - SCC is requesting to add a new <br />requirement to compensate for the reduction in warm-season grass cover. The new <br />requirement is "for the presence of two different species in each life-form category." <br />Please list the life-forms in which two species will be required. <br />SCC: Please note paragraph 3 of new permit page 14-24 that was submitted <br />with the original technical revision application on January 17, 2011. The life-forms in <br />question, cool-season grasses, warm-season grasses, and forbs and suffrutescent (sub- <br />shrub) species, and the new criteria "at least two species present in the reclamation <br />(observed)" are more fully discussed. <br />2. DRMS: Page A14-11-4, Sampling Methodology - The text states that SCC <br />"intends to implement Cedar Creek's (CCA) recommendation regarding sampling design <br />and procedure for final bond release evaluation starting in 2011." The Division feels the <br />methods used by CCA are justified and superior to the currently approved method. If <br />SCC wants to change the sampling design and procedures that are outlined in the <br />approved permit, then the following items need to be addressed: <br />a. Remove the sentence stating "... DRMS will be contacted for approval of <br />final Sampling methodology" in the Revegetation Success Criteria section on <br />page 14-22. <br />SCC: The sentence has been removed from permit page 14-22 and revised <br />page is enclosed. <br />b. Amend the text in Tab 14 to reflect the new sampling design and <br />procedures outlined by CCA.
